METHOD OF MEASURING DISTANCE TO MONITORED FACILITY Russian patent published in 2012 - IPC G01S15/08 

Abstract RU 2452977 C1

FIELD: physics.

SUBSTANCE: periodic pulsed acoustic signal is generated at the monitored facility using a vertically aligned four-module antenna whose modules are arranged in pairs symmetrically about the surface of the sea bed, wherein the top and bottom modules are excited in antiphase with respect to the other two modules lying in between them. The antenna is mounted at the sea bed. Antenna emission is synchronised with zero time at the reception point on the monitored facility. The acoustic signal is received at the monitored facility using two receivers. One of the receivers lies directly on the ground and is a vector receiver at whose output the vertical and horizontal components of the oscillating velocity vector are measured. The second receiver is a directional acoustic pressure receiver. Group lag time is determined from the measured parameters while preliminarily determining time intervals. The yaw angle at the reception point is determined based on the measured values of the component of the oscillating velocity vector. The unknown distance to the monitored facility is calculated using invariant speed equal to the speed of the bottom wave and the group lag time.

EFFECT: reduced measurement error.
